“Impact qualified community development entity” means:
1. A partnership, limited-liability company or corporation that has its principal business operations in this State and is engaged in lending or other investment activity;
2. A qualified community development entity that complies with NRS 221A.180; or
3. A qualified community development financial institution, as that term is defined in the Community Development Banking and Financial Institutions Act of 1994, 12 U.S.C. § 4702(5).
